Crispy Pan-Fried Barramundi with Lemon Herb Butter Sauce

Difficulty: MEDIUM

Prep Time: 10 minutes

Cook Time: 15 minutes

Total Time: 25 minutes

Serving Size: Serves 2

Ingredients:

  • 2 barramundi fillets
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 3 tbsp unsalted butter
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 lemon, juiced
  • 2 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ped

Directions:

  1. Pat dry barramundi fillets with paper towels.
  2. In a shallow dish, combine flour, salt, and pepper. Dredge each fillet in the seasoned flour, shaking off any excess.
  3.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add barramundi fillets and cook for 3-4 minutes per side until crispy and cooked through. Remove from skillet and set aside.
  4. In the same skillet, melt butter. Add minced garlic and cook for 1 minute until fragrant.
  5. Stir in lemon juice and chopped parsley. Cook for another minute.
  6. Pour the lemon herb butter sauce over the pan-fried barramundi fillets.
  7. Serve hot and enjoy!
